Trusses Installation in Wilmington, NC
Trusses installation services involve the setup of structural frameworks that support roofs, floors, or walls in residential properties. These services are commonly utilized in new construction projects, home extensions, or renovations where a strong, reliable framework is essential. Property owners typically seek truss installation to ensure their building’s stability, manage load distribution effectively, and meet building code requirements. Understanding the different types of trusses, such as attic, flat, or gable trusses, can help homeowners determine the best solution for their specific project needs.
Before requesting trusses installation, property owners should consider factors like the size and design of their property, the intended use of the space, and any architectural preferences. It’s important to clarify the scope of work, including the type of trusses required and the overall project timeline. Additionally, understanding the foundation and support structures in place can influence the selection and installation process. Proper planning and clear communication about these details can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and meets the structural demands of the property.

Trusses Installation Questions
What types of projects typically require truss installation? Trusses are commonly used in roof framing for residential and commercial buildings, as well as for large-span structures and renovations.
How do I know if my property needs new trusses? Signs include sagging roofs, uneven ceilings, or structural concerns after damage or remodeling projects.
What materials are used for trusses? Wood and metal are the most common materials, chosen based on the project's structural requirements and design preferences.
What should property owners consider before installing trusses? It's important to evaluate the building's design, load requirements, and compatibility with existing structures before installation.
